Gift Monday: Nigeria forward pens three-year contract extension with Tenerife

By Oyediji Oluwaseun Babatunde

Nigeria forward Gift Monday has officially renewed her contract with Spanish Liga F side Costa Adeje Tenerife for three more seasons, keeping her with the club until 2026.

Club President Sergio Batista emphasized that this renewal is a vital reward for their standout players.

Expressing her gratitude, Monday stated that the renewal provides her with the opportunity to grow alongside the team.

“My dream is to help the team, contribute positively to achieve victories, and win more games,” she shared.

“I felt the support of the entire club, the love of my teammates, and the overall environment.”

In her third season with Tenerife, Monday originally joined from FC Robo Queens in the Nigerian Women Football League (NWFL) Premiership during the 2022/2023 season.

She scored three goals and provided three assists in her first season, followed by an impressive six goals and one assist in the 2023/2024 campaign.

So far this season, she has already netted two goals and contributed one assist after just two league games.

Monday promised fans that she will continue to give her best for the club.
